Wow. I have never posted anything thats gotten that much of a responce. Figured I'd give a bit of a follow up to that post-

I gained an interest in the show mainly through learning about the history behind it and just how ahead of its time and influential of a show it is. Thus far I've really enjoyed it. Even the weaker episodes all had something interesting or well written going on (I seriously don't see the hate for TKO), and the great episodes are really good.

Season 2 kept the momentum going, the feud between the Narns and Centari has been the definite highlight. The loss of Sinclair really sucks, especially knowing the irl circumstances behind it. But on the bright side, Sheridan has been great addition to the cast and they've done a fantastic job making him not just Sinclair MK.2.

In terms of gripes, its really just down to Na'toth being absent for 90% of the season and my finding Warren Keffer to be uninteresting. But beyond that- great stuff. And season 3 has been even better thus far.

From what I recall, JMS originally offered the explanation that:

1. He had written the character of Jeffrey Sinclair to be something of a warrior-philosopher (which makes a great deal of sense if you are familiar with the character's eventual fate); with considerable emphasis on the 'philosopher' component in the first season.

2. From the second season forward, Sinclair would adopt a more action-oriented role, and drive the main story arc forward.

3. He hadn't laid the necessary groundwork for this change; and having written himself into a corner, JMS opted to exercise one of his famous 'trapdoors' and switch Sinclair out for John Sheridan.

The reasoning wasn't wholly implausible (imagine, for instance, Sinclair deploying nuclear weapons with the same sort of joyful abandon as Sheridan); and the timing happened to coincide with the introduction of Hotshot Network Note Warren Keffer (which lent some credence to the idea that TNT had a hand in the change)

To give full credit to JMS: not only did he protect Michael O'Hare's reputation (and kept the actor's mental health struggles in confidence until after his passing), but he did so by offering up a cover story that placed the blame entirely on his own shoulders.

If I had a nickel for every time a 90s sci-fi show had to write out a character who had visions and other mental power things, because their actor developed severe mental health issues, only for the producers to lie about why they'd been written out for decades afterwards? And they came back once or twice for a cameo?

I'd have 10 cents, but it's still weird that it happened twice.

(Kes played by Jennifer Lien on Star Trek: Voyager and Jeffery Sinclair played by Michael O'Hare on Babylon 5)
